Question 1 

1. A deer population increases in size from 2000 to 2300 individuals over one year. Calculate the growth rate of the poulation in this time interval.

part b) determine the per captia growth rate of deer

2. Suppose that a small backyard ponbd contains 25 Lemma minor plants, and the expected growth rate of the population is 1.0 x 10^2 plants per day. Predict how many Lemma minor plants the pond will contain after 31 days.

I think these are the answers, though if someone else wants to check them that would be cool.

1a) 300/1 = 300 dear/year
b) (2300-2000)/2000 = 0.15

2) cgr= N/t
N= (cgr)(t)
N= (1.0x10^2)(31)
N= 3100 + 25 (25 from the original population)
= 3125 total number of plants
